Cardiovascular disease (CVD) care in the Caribbean shows improvements but lags behind high-income nations. Addressing social determinants like diet and lifestyle is crucial for better CVD outcomes and reduced mortality.

Area of Science:

  • Public Health
  • Cardiology
  • Epidemiology

Background:

  • Cardiovascular diseases (CVD) pose a significant public health challenge in the Caribbean.
  • While improvements in cardiovascular care exist, they fall short of expectations.

Purpose of the Study:

  • To analyze the epidemiology and risk factors of CVD in the Caribbean.
  • To identify gaps in cardiovascular care compared to high-income countries.
  • To evaluate patient outcomes, including quality of life and mortality.

Main Methods:

  • A systematic review of peer-reviewed articles on CVD in the Caribbean from 1959 to 2022.
  • Data extraction and classification based on epidemiological profile, risk factors, management, and outcomes.
  • Analysis of 36 selected studies from various Caribbean nations.

Main Results:

  • High prevalence of CVD risk factors, including those linked to social determinants like fast food consumption and sedentary lifestyles.
  • Suboptimal cardiovascular care, poor patient compliance, and high inpatient mortality rates were observed.
  • Significant disparities exist when compared to high-income countries.

Conclusions:

  • Greater efforts are needed to enhance cardiovascular care across all stages in the Caribbean.
  • Addressing social and environmental factors is essential for mitigating CVD risks.
  • Improving care quality and patient compliance is vital to reduce mortality.
